    • The genetic nomenclature of the aflatoxin biosynthetic pathway is designated throughout this and the accompanying paper according to the recently published ordering of Yu et al. (Yu, J.; Chang, P. K.; Ehrlich, K. C.; Cary, J. W.; Bhatnagar, D.; Cleveland, T. E.; Payne, G. A.; Linz, J. E.; Woloshuk, C. P.; Bennett, J. W. Appl. Environ. Microbiol. 2004, 70, 1253-1262). In this review, the aflatoxin genes, originally named according to their respective substrate or enzymatic function, were standardized with the three-letter code "afl" and arranged alphabetically according to their ordering in vivo: aflG = avnA, aflL = verB, aflM = ver1, aflN = aflS, aflO = omtI, aflP = omtII, and aflQ = ordA.
